Research Assistant
Through a collaboration with the United States Department of Agriculture in Peoria, IL, I studied the role of putative genes in trehalose metabolism in Fusarium verticillioides. We found that trehalose-6-phosphate synthase was the key enzyme in the trehalose biosynthetic pathway. Deletion of this enzyme resulted in a decrease of trehalose, as expected, but also a decrease in the toxin fumonosin leading to a less pathogenic fungi. Our results suggest that trehalose metabolism is a viable target for control of Fusarium.
